Abstract
E-Learning Management System is a web based Learning Management System that helps students to interactively learn a new course, allow course experts to learn new courses on different subjects. The purpose of this E-Learning Management System project is to develop a front-end application for e-learning applications and queries using graphical user interface. It delivers its data so that each analysis application can receive only the information it needs and in the format required.
